    I had the same experience with two mail order BPs from a big online breeder (my first two). Both were extremely snappy out of the box and one spent the whole week striking from inside his cage even if you entered the room. I think their fear level was pretty raised from the whole process of being bulk bred and shipped.

    After moving them to smaller tubs and giving them some time (actually less handling) to fully calm down and relax in their environment, they have changed personalities 180 degrees in a month.

    They still are a bit more head shy, but are much more calm and haven't taken up the defensive striking pose in weeks. Now they will actually become curious and wander around and let me pet their heads. I was pretty despondent the first couple weeks though because every time I held them it was either trying to strike or frantically trying to run away and escape my grip.
